If `2 .5 xx 10^(-6) N` average force is exerted by a light wave on a non-reflecting surface of `30 cm^(2)` area during 40 minutes of time span, the energy flux of light just before it falls on the surface is `"____________" W //cm^(2)`. ( Round off to the Nearest Integer )
(Assume complete absorption and normal incidence conditions are there )
